Architecture decisions that show up in the day-to-day, not just the marketing slide.
Route exceptions to the right person, escalate stalled tasks, and trigger notifications without writing code. The platform's event stream feeds a no-code rules engine your operators can actually use.
Native integrations for Shopify, Amazon, WooCommerce, and TikTok Shop are on the roadmap. Order-import webhooks and a typed event API are available today for custom connections.
Every billable event — stops, labels, storage, picks — is captured at the moment it happens, not reconstructed at month end. Invoices reflect what actually occurred, with full audit trail.
Receiving exceptions, photo-attached PODs, signature capture, and disposition-level returns workflows give you the documentation big-box retail clients ask for.
Tenant isolation isn't bolted on. Every table, query, and policy is tenant-aware from day one — built specifically for warehouses serving multiple clients, not retrofitted from a single-brand WMS.
Migrate in days, not months. Bring your existing data with the CSV import flow. Smart field mapping handles non-matching column names automatically. Most mid-size 3PLs are operational on Deliver WMS within a week.
